The Carson girls soccer team scored six goals in the both the first and second halves on Saturday as they beat Wooster 12-0 at Carson High.
Three Senator players scored their first goals of the season. Defenders Sarah Carmone and Carolina Hernandez both scored first-half goals. And goalie Krissy Rose scored two goals in the second half after playing between the pipes in the first.
Allison Williamson had five assists and Bria Dankworth had three more for Carson, whose next game is Tuesday against South Tahoe.
The Senators (13-1) are still two games ahead of Douglas (11-3) in the Sierra League standings. The Tigers play at Carson on Thursday.
